Types of Vibrators
Now that you have a better understanding of your needs, let’s dive into the different types of vibrators available in the market. Vibrators come in a variety of shapes, sizes, and functions. It’s important to explore the options and choose one that aligns with your preferences.
Classic Vibrator
The classic vibrator is a timeless choice for individuals exploring both internal and external stimulation. Its versatile design features a phallic shape that can be inserted into the vagina or used to stimulate the clitoris externally. Available in various sizes and materials, classic vibrators cater to different comfort levels and preferences. Many models include adjustable speed and intensity settings, making them ideal for beginners and experienced users alike. Their simplicity and adaptability make them a popular and reliable option.
Bullet Vibrator
A bullet vibrator is perfect for those seeking precise, targeted external stimulation. Small and discreet, these vibrators are designed for clitoral use and fit comfortably in the hand, making them easy to manoeuvre. They’re also great for enhancing partner play during intercourse. Despite their compact size, bullet vibrators are often powerful, offering a range of speed settings for a customised experience. Their portability and ease of use make them an excellent choice for travel or everyday intimacy.
Wand Vibrator
The wand vibrator is a powerful tool for intense external stimulation. Larger than most vibrators, it delivers deep, rumbly vibrations that are particularly effective for clitoral and other erogenous zone stimulation. Originally designed as a muscle massager, its versatility has made it a bedroom favourite. Wand vibrators come in both corded and cordless options, providing flexibility for different needs. Many models also feature multiple speeds and patterns, ensuring a satisfying and tailored experience for users.
Rabbit Vibrator
A rabbit vibrator is ideal for those who crave simultaneous internal and external stimulation. It features a curved shaft designed to target the G-spot, paired with a clitoral stimulator for dual pleasure. These vibrators often include various vibration patterns and intensity levels, allowing for customisable sensations. Their innovative design caters to users seeking comprehensive stimulation, making them a staple in many collections. The combination of functionality and pleasure ensures an unforgettable experience.
G-Spot Vibrator
The G-spot vibrator is crafted for those who enjoy focused internal stimulation. Its curved design is specifically tailored to target the G-spot, a highly sensitive area within the vagina. Many models include textured surfaces or varying vibration settings to enhance pleasure further. Whether used solo or with a partner, these vibrators are perfect for exploring deeper, more intense sensations. Their ergonomic shape ensures comfort and precision, making them a popular choice for intimate exploration.
Couple’s Vibrator
Couple’s vibrators are designed to bring an extra dimension to shared intimacy. These innovative devices are worn during intercourse, providing clitoral and internal stimulation for both partners. They come in various shapes, ensuring a comfortable fit and enhancing pleasure for both individuals. Many models offer remote controls or app connectivity, adding a playful element to the experience. Ideal for spicing up your sex life, couple’s vibrators foster connection while amplifying pleasure for both partners.

Considerations Before Buying
Now that you have an idea of the different types of vibrators available, there are a few important factors to consider before making your purchase. These considerations will ensure that you choose a vibrator that suits your needs and preferences.
Material and Safety
When buying a vibrator, it’s important to consider the material it’s made of and its safety features.
Look for vibrators made from body-safe materials such as medical-grade silicone or ABS plastic. These materials are non-porous, hypoallergenic, and easy to clean. Avoid vibrators made from materials that may contain harmful chemicals or cause irritation.
Power Source
Consider the power source of the vibrator you’re interested in.
Some vibrators are battery-operated, while others are rechargeable or plug into a power source. Battery-operated vibrators can be convenient for travel but may require frequent battery replacements. Rechargeable vibrators, on the other hand, offer consistent power and are more environmentally friendly.
Noise Level
If discretion is important to you, consider the noise level of the vibrator.
Some vibrators are designed to be whisper-quiet, while others may produce more noticeable sounds. Look for vibrators that have a reputation for being discreet and quiet, especially if you live with roommates or have thin walls.
Price Range
Set a budget for your vibrator purchase. Vibrators come in a wide range of prices, from budget-friendly options to high-end luxury models.
While it’s tempting to splurge on a high-end vibrator, there are plenty of affordable options that can provide just as much pleasure. Consider what features are important to you and find a vibrator that fits within your budget.

Cleaning and Maintenance
Once you’ve found the perfect vibrator, it’s important to know how to clean and maintain it properly. Proper hygiene will ensure the longevity of your vibrator and reduce the risk of infections or irritations.
Here are some tips for cleaning and maintaining your vibrator.
- Read the manufacturer’s instructions. Different vibrators may have specific cleaning instructions, so always refer to the manufacturer’s guidelines.
- Use mild soap and water: Most vibrators can be cleaned with mild soap and warm water.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that may damage the material.
- Remove batteries or unplug: Before cleaning your vibrator, remove the batteries or unplug it if it’s rechargeable. This will prevent any electrical issues or accidental activation.
- Pay attention to waterproofing: If your vibrator is waterproof, you can clean it more thoroughly by submerging it in water. If it’s not waterproof, use a damp cloth or toy cleaner to wipe it down.
- Store it properly: After cleaning, make sure your vibrator is completely dry before storing it. Store it in a clean and dry place, away from direct sunlight or extreme temperatures.
Additional Tips for a Pleasurable Experience
To enhance your experience with your new vibrator, here are some additional tips and tricks.
- Use lubrication: Adding a water-based lubricant can increase comfort and pleasure during vibrator use. Avoid using silicone-based lubricants with silicone vibrators, as it can damage the material.
- Start slow: If you’re new to using vibrators, start with lower intensity settings and gradually increase as you become more comfortable. Take your time to explore different sensations and find what works best for you.
- Communicate with your partner: If you’re using a vibrator with a partner, communication is key. Discuss your desires, boundaries, and preferences to ensure a pleasurable and consensual experience for both of you.
- Explore different settings and patterns: Many vibrators offer various vibration patterns and intensities. Take the time to experiment with different settings to discover what brings you the most pleasure.
- Have fun and be open-minded: Exploring your sexuality and pleasure should be a fun and positive experience. Be open-minded, embrace your desires, and enjoy the journey of self-discovery.

Prioritizing Your Safety
Safety should always be a priority when it comes to using sex toys. Here are some important safety tips to keep in mind.
Choose Body-Safe Materials
When selecting a sex toy, prioritise those made from body-safe materials such as medical-grade silicone, ABS plastic, or stainless steel. These materials are non-porous, hypoallergenic, and free from harmful chemicals, ensuring they won’t irritate or harm your body. Avoid toys made from jelly or rubber, which may contain phthalates or other unsafe substances. Investing in high-quality, body-safe products not only enhances your experience but also protects your health in the long run.
Check for Certifications
Before purchasing, check if the toy has safety certifications like CE or RoHS. These certifications confirm that the product meets international safety standards and has been tested for harmful substances. Reputable brands often display these marks to guarantee the quality and safety of their products. Checking for certifications provides peace of mind, ensuring that the toy you’re using is designed with your safety and well-being in mind.
Clean Before and After Use
Proper hygiene is crucial to preventing infections and maintaining safety. Always clean your toys before and after each use using warm water and a mild soap or a specialised toy cleaner. Follow the manufacturer’s cleaning instructions, especially for toys with electronic components. For waterproof toys, thorough washing is straightforward, while non-waterproof toys may require surface cleaning. Keeping your toys clean ensures they remain safe and hygienic for every use.
Use Condoms or Barriers
If sharing sex toys with a partner, using condoms or barriers is a simple yet effective way to maintain safety. Condoms prevent the spread of bacteria or STIs, especially when toys are used for anal and vaginal play interchangeably. This practice is particularly important when sharing toys with different partners. Switching condoms or thoroughly cleaning toys between uses adds an extra layer of protection, ensuring peace of mind during play.
Replace When Necessary
Inspect your toys regularly for signs of damage, such as cracks, tears, or discolouration. Damaged toys can harbour bacteria or cause discomfort during use. If you notice wear and tear, it’s time to replace the toy to avoid potential risks. Even high-quality toys have a lifespan, so keeping an eye on their condition ensures your continued safety. Investing in new toys when needed is essential for a safe and enjoyable experience.

How do I choose the right material for a vibrator?
Body-safe materials like medical-grade silicone, ABS plastic, or stainless steel are the safest and most comfortable options. Silicone is soft, hypoallergenic, and easy to clean, making it ideal for beginners. ABS plastic offers a firm, smooth texture, while stainless steel provides a weighty, luxurious feel. Avoid porous materials like jelly or rubber, which can harbour bacteria and potentially contain harmful chemicals.
